Output edc7903ae89b8d76b481200e446de5331fb85862b8789100f384d491eab6e22e:0

value
601619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806b70d72bdc0b5f17e29d38838ee854baf13318 OP_EQUAL
address
3DQ38DPy3NxNWDbGeCM1gSvdYwTVsKSN4r
transaction
edc7903ae89b8d76b481200e446de5331fb85862b8789100f384d491eab6e22e
confirmations
301687
spent
true